In the 652nd year of the Yan Dynasty, natural disasters such as floods, locust plagues, earthquakes, and droughts hit most parts of the country, including Shenzhou. Countless people were displaced and lost their homes.
In order to resist the Yanqing Emperor's brutal and licentious rule, the people in the disaster-stricken areas rose up in resistance, among which three uprising armies were the most famous and powerful.
The three rebel armies were led by Xie Liu, Wu Gou and Lin Nan.
Among them, the headquarters of Xie Liu’s rebel army was located in the mansion of Liu Kai, the prefect of Shenzhou County.
As the governor of a province and the highest-ranking local official, Liu Kai's mansion was naturally magnificent and extravagant, covering an area of tens of thousands of square meters.
Xie Liu was extremely satisfied with using Liu Kai's mansion as the capital.
Perhaps, the place where the emperor lives far away in the Forbidden City is just like this.
That day he finished his official duties and resolved a dispute among his subordinates over land, then leisurely returned to his mansion to check on the progress of the dragon robe made by the embroiderer.
The embroiderers found it difficult to start with the bright yellow fabric, and could only use their imagination to embroider a dragon claw. When they saw Xie Liu, they knelt down in fear and said:
"Greetings, sir..."
"You should call me Emperor, have you forgotten?" Xie Liu's face darkened.
Although he had not yet officially put on the dragon robe and held a formal ceremony to worship the heavens and enthrone himself as emperor in front of the people, he was already eager to give himself a title.
"Your Majesty, please forgive me. I didn't mean it..." One of the embroiderers quickly apologized, while the other sisters beside her shrank their shoulders tremblingly, trying to reduce their presence.
Unexpectedly, Xie Liu's face darkened again:
"Who gave you the right to call yourself me?"
The embroiderer's face turned pale. Although Xie Liu was born into a farming family, he had killed many people recently, so his momentum was inevitably more fierce. When he got angry, his momentum was even stronger. The embroiderer was so scared that she couldn't speak clearly:
"Your Majesty, please forgive me. I didn't mean it. Please forgive me..."
Hearing this, Xie Liu nodded in satisfaction. He sat on a stool in the middle of the embroidery room. Another servant had already poured him a cup of hot tea on the table.
He deliberately slowed down his pace and took a sip, trying to be as elegant as the nobles. However, due to habit, he did not know how to be elegant and instead got his mouth scalded by the scalding tea.
Then, his face darkened again, and he took out his anger on the embroiderer:
"It's been three days, why hasn't the dragon robe been embroidered yet? What use do I have for you?"
It was the embroiderer who had just begged for mercy who spoke again:
"Your Majesty, the dragon robe is too complicated to make. We have never seen a real dragon robe, so we can only embroider the dragon claws based on our experience..."
"You didn't do your job well. Go and receive your punishment in the evening." Xie Liu said.
The embroiderers' bodies instantly collapsed, but they still had to suppress their fear and kowtow in response.
After Xie Liu left, the servants who served him also left. The embroiderers looked at each other with bitterness in their eyes.
Everyone says that the current emperor is a tyrant, but why do they, who have been in contact with Xie Liu day and night, feel that he is not much different from the new emperor?
When he was recruiting people, he said nice things like "I come from a peasant family just like you, and if you join me in rebellion, I will definitely not treat you unfairly."
Now he hasn't even become emperor yet, but he's already using his usual punishment tactics...
